The Ready Rooftop

Fresh to the rooftop scene is The Ready Rooftop, perched above the Moxy East Village. With it’s eclectic décor – think string lights, a vine-strewn mural and bar made of plastic milk crates – and unique food & bev offerings. The retractable glass walls and roof also allow for all-season panoramic views of the East Village. We love to see it.
When: Wednesday-Sunday 4PM-10PM
Where: 112 E 11th St, New York, NY 10003
Westlight

Toast your rooftop rosé because Westlight NYC is back, 22 stories above the William Vale Hotel. Sip on craft cocktails while taking in panoramic skyline views of Manhattan and thinking about how grateful you are to not be quarantined at your parents’ house in South Dakota.
Hours: Monday-Thursday 5PM-11PM, Friday 5PM-12AM, Saturday 1PM-12AM, Sunday 1PM-11PM
Where: 111 N 12th St 22nd Floor, Brooklyn, NY 11249
Ampia Rooftop

Greenhouses. For outdoor dining. Now that really is groundbreaking. Welcome to Ampia, meaning space in Italian – and that’s exactly what you’ll get. Social distance with friends in your own private greenhouse, surrounded by live music, colorful flower gardens, and Italian-themed art and décor dispersed throughout.
Hours: Monday-Friday 4PM-11PM, Saturday-Sunday 12PM-11PM
Where: 100 Broad Street, 2nd Fl Entrance on Bridge Street b/t Broad St and, Whitehall St, New York, NY 10004
Sandbar Rooftop

The Hamptons on an NYC rooftop. New to the block on August 28th, Sandbar Rooftop brings soothing coastal vibes to the concrete jungle. Experience a beach escape with lifeguard chairs, hanging lounges, and swings created from reclaimed wine barrels – all while soaking in 360-degree views of Manhattan.
Where: 152 W 26th St, New York, NY 10001
Hours: Wednesday-Sunday 4:30PM-11PM
Azul Rooftop

“Alexa, play Havana by Camila Cabello on repeat until I tell you to stop.” With its Old Havana-oh-na-na vibes, Hotel Hugo adds some color and warmth to even the cloudiest of days. While their sangria pairs perfectly with summer nights on the seasonal Azul Rooftop, head indoors when the temperatures drop to enjoy a blood orange cosmo in the year-round Bar Hugo.
Hours: Open Monday-Friday at 5PM, Weekends starting at 3PM
Where: 525 Greenwich St, New York, NY 10013
